Miscellaneous records, 1930-1961.

Accounting reports (irregular intervals, 1930-1961), property inventories (1933, 1935, 1937, 1957, 1961), and historical sketch (1942) documenting the operation of a sawmill in Klamath Falls (Ore.) owned by a northern California lumbering firm and in which the Great Northern had a large financial interest.

0.5 cu. ft. (8 folders in partial box).

Kesterson Lumber Company.

http://n2t.net/ark:/99166/w6422xxs (corporateBody)

The company leased a land tract from GN in 1929, on which it constructed a sawmill partially financed by GN. GN was the carrier of lumber produced at the site. The GN interest in the property was managed by its subsidiary, the Washington and Great Northern Townsite Company. From the description of Miscellaneous records, 1930-1961. (Unknown). The Rexford, Mont., station of the Great Northern Railway was established in 1903. It was closed in 1972 when the railroad was rerouted due to the flooding of the area behind the Libby Dam. The building was moved to Eureka where it became part of the Tobacco Valley Historical Village Museum. From the description of Records of the Rexford Station, Rexford, Mont., 1952-1970. (Unknown).
